By Sam Efromovich

The methodological improvement of integer programming has grown via leaps and boundaries long ago 4 many years, with its major specialise in linear integer programming. despite the fact that, the earlier few years have additionally witnessed convinced promising theoretical and methodological achievements in nonlinear integer programming. those fresh advancements have produced functions of nonlinear (mixed) integer programming throughout a number of a number of components of clinical computing, engineering, administration technology and operations examine. Its widespread purposes contain, for examples, portfolio choice, capital budgeting, construction making plans, source allocation, laptop networks, reliability networks and chemical engineering.

In popularity of nonlinearity's educational importance in optimization and its significance in actual international purposes, NONLINEAR INTEGER PROGRAMMING is a entire and systematic remedy of the technique. The book's objective is to carry the cutting-edge of the theoretical starting place and resolution tools for nonlinear integer programming to scholars and researchers in optimization, operations study, and computing device technological know-how. This publication systemically investigates idea and resolution methodologies for normal nonlinear integer programming, and while, presents a well timed and complete precis of the theoretical and algorithmic improvement within the final 30 years in this subject. the next are a few good points of the book:

Duality idea for nonlinear integer programming is carefully discussed.

Convergent Lagrangian and slicing tools for separable nonlinear integer programming are defined and demonstrated.

Convexification scheme and the relation among the monotonicity and convexity is explored and illustrated.

A resolution framework is supplied utilizing international descent.

Computational implementations for large-scale nonlinear integer programming difficulties are verified for a number of effective resolution algorithms provided within the book.

10) gives rise to ^x* < b. 8) that D c^x* — c^x. 2 31 Linearly constrained separable convex integer program The proximity results in the previous subsection can be extended to separable convex programming problems. t. t. , TI, are all convex functions on M, A is an integer m X n matrix and b 6 R^. 12) both exist. 11) such that THEOREM < nA{A). 12) such that \x — z\ < n/\{A). 14) Proof. 11), respectively. 12) with the minimal box that contains x and z. 15) Then S'* can be expressed as {x E M^ | A*x < 6*}.

X f } . Remove {P{Xi)) from L^ and set L:= LUL^U Lf. Go to Step 1. Step 5 (Fathoming). Remove {P{Xi)) from L^. If i < k, SQii := i + 1 and return to Step 2. Otherwise, go to Step 4. 1. 1 stops at an optimal solution to (P) within a finite number of iterations. Proof. Note that the fathoming procedure, either in Step 3 or Step 5 of the algorithm, will not remove any feasible solution of (P) better than the incumbent. Notice that X is finite. Thus only a finite number of branching steps can be executed.

K), where K = 2^. 4) 28 NONLINEAR INTEGER PROGRAMMING where A == {7 G R^ | J^f^i ji = 1, -fi > 0, i = 1,... ,K}. It is clear that 0 is a piecewise Hnear convex function on conv{X). 5) and f{x) = (/)(x) for all x e Q. Recall that f{x) and (/)(x) have the same global optimal value over conv{X) (see [182]). Notice that a concave function always achieves its minimum over a polyhedron at one of the extreme points. Also, the extreme points of conv{X) are integer points. p,/i€M^ {4>{x) I Ax < 6, Bx = d} xEconv{X) < min {/(x) \ Ax

